Dons Win Opener in Huber Classic; Play in Semifinals Wednesday, December 29th, 8:00pm at Acalanes

On Tuesday the Dons hosted their first game in this year’s Chris Huber Classic, facing El Cerrito. There was a great home crowd to cheer on the team…hope to see everyone again! Acalanes got off to a strong start with Jack Bayless slashing for 3 buckets, then Jake adding 10 including a 3 in the quarter and Theo adding a 3 and a driving layup to lead 25-15 after the first.

El Cerrito came out firing in the second half cutting the Dons lead to 4, but some better shots including 2 cutting layups from Noah and strong offensive rebounding across the squad helped the Dons get their footing back, and a 7 point lead at half after a late Noah three, 43-36.

Acalanes started the second half where they left off with Jack converting an and-1 following an offensive rebound and Noah burying another 3 after a stop. Tate Nelson then cashed a fast break to push the Don lead to 15. Two more baskets from Jake and a Tate 3 made it 17. Tyler Murphy got hit first point of the game with a free throw and Theo fired up the bench taking a charge. The scoring slowed later in the half with El Cerrito’s hot shooting keeping them in it, 59-47 at the end of Q3.

The Don shooting started off cold in Q4 but Colin Norstad collected 4 offensive rebounds to add to the chances early, one converted to a Justin Zegarowski banked leaner. A nice pocket pass from Zubin Acuna turned into 2 free throws from Theo, and the sweet passing continued with Jordan Brown feeding Colin for an alley-oop layup to keep the Don lead at 11. Zubin came through with a 3 to get it to 14, but El Cerrito countered with a 3 of their own. A Jack slash and Theo backdoor cut got it back to a comfortable 15 point lead, and a final floater from Theo iced the game 74-59. Top scorers were Jake with 21, Jack with 17 and Theo with 13.
